| Fiorentina – Lyon: Draw @ 3.30 (Stan James) 10/10 A draw serves both teams in terms of qualification. Above all else, Fiorentina does not want to lose, although a win would clinch things. A loss would give Liverpool realistic chances whereas a draw would allow Fiorentina to even lose the next match and still qualify. Lyon, on the other hand, has qualified and a draw also would make them likely winners of the group. There isn’t a great difference between the teams, with Lyon being only slightly better in my opinion. Essentially, the perceived dynamics of the match point to a likely draw result. Alkmaar – Olympiacos: Olympiacos (+0.5) AH @ 1.76 (Bet 1128) 10/10 The first CL group, match between these teams ended in a 1-0 win for Olympiacos. I think that match indicated that there isn’t much between the teams. Olympiacos has an advantage regarding qualification to the next round. A draw will do them fine whereas Alkmaar must win to have any chance, albeit small. Hence, Alkmaar will push very hard and this will leave space for Olympiacos. The visitors are more than capable of scoring and they may just even win this match given Alkmaar’s all or nothing offensive approach. Olympiacos will be especially careful at the back with the aim of getting at least the draw. The odds aren’t great for Olympiacos on the AH, but they are acceptable, I think. Rangers – Stuttgart: Over 2.5 goals @ 2.12 (Canbet) 10/10 Both teams will hope they get some help from Seville against Unirea in their effort to qualify. Only a win really improves either team’s chances so tactics for a draw will not be entertained. Both teams will come out wanting to win the match and they will be looking for goals. Neither team has shown that they have a particularly reliable defensive line and we should get at least 3 goals here. Rubin Kazan – Dinamo Kiev: Rubin Kazan @ 2.10 (Betfair) 10/10 I don’t think Rubin Kazan will let the opportunity to advance in the CL get away. They have good momentum, at the moment, having celebrated winning the Russian title. This is a team that got 4 out of 6 points from Barcelona and a draw from Inter. Dinamo is a competitive team, but I think the hosts are also a competitive team and here they have the home advantage and good momentum going into this match. Finally, Dynamo Kiev has 15 players on the Ukrainian National Team. A week ago they played two tough matches against Greece and were eliminated from the World Cup. In terms of fatigue and positive psychology this can’t be good, I think. Odds over 2.00 are quite good for Rubin’s win here. |

| Liverpool -1.5 @ 1.91 pinnacle Liverpool -2.5 @ 3.20 bet365 Liverpool not only have to win this game but also need to score quite a few goals in order to have a chance to progress through. If Lyon win against Fiorentina, then they only need to win this game and the next against Fiorentina to progress, or if there is a draw between the other two teams, then if Liverpool win by 3 goals here, then they will need to win byt 3 against Fiorentina, however if they win by 4 goals against Debrecen, then they only need 2 goals against Fiorentina - all this provided the other game does not see Fiorentina win. Liverpool were much the better side against Lyon only to draw to a sucker punch in the last miuntes of the game. They also were the better team against Man City on the weekend before some defensive mix ups saw them draw that one too. They outplayed Debrecen at home even though some poor finishing saw it only end 1-0. They have most of their players now back from injury and given the magnitude of a must win game by several goals, expect them to show their class difference with an emphatic victory, otherwise they can forget about progressing any further in this competition. Arsenal -1.5 @ 1.90 pinnacle Arsenal -2.5 @ 3.05 bet365 While Arsenal only need a draw to progress, they are not a team that is built to sit on a point, as Wenger wants then to regularly attack. They have some very creative players like Fabregas and Arshavin in the team, and even though they suffered a shock 1-0 loss to Sunderland on the weekend, they still had the chances to score. They should be still able to create similar amount of chances against a Standard Liege side that has an outside chance of progressing and are likley to be missing some key players like Jovanovic and De Camargo. Arsenal seem to play much better at home than on the road in the Champions League and with results like 2-0 over Olympiacos and 4-1 ove AZ Alkmaar, they have the ability to score quite a few against Liege |

| Arsenal v Liege Arsenal have been brilliant at home so far this season, reacing the -1 handicap in everygame bar the 2-1 Carling Cup win over Liverpool. We've scored 33 goals in 10 games so far and only conceded 7. Liege on the other hand have poor away form, scoring only 3 in their last 5 away games, conceding 7, against much weaker teams than Arsenal. Arsenal are without Van Persie but welcome back Walcott and Denilson into the team, whilst Arshavin, Vela, Eduardo, Rosicky, Nasri and Fabregas offer plenty going forward. Arsenal only need 1 point to qualify but they won't sit back, especially after failing to score at the weekend, and I feel poor Liege could be in for a bit of a battering.
